1. Executive Summary & Global Commercial Landscape

Foreign body airway obstruction (FBAO) remains one of the leading causes of accidental death globally, particularly among infants, toddlers, and the elderly. While the standard Heimlich Maneuver is widely taught in basic life support (BLS) modules, the real-world challenge lies in executing the Heimlich Maneuver by yourself when choking alone. Historically, public health initiatives focused solely on bystander resuscitation. Today, the rise of home healthcare, remote labor, and single-living dynamics has driven massive market demand for affordable, accessible self-rescue training tools, simulation wear, and specialized emergency suction or pressure devices.

The industrial landscape for simulator models has shifted from simple, low-fidelity plastic manikins to smart, feedback-driven simulation systems. 2. Biomechanical Challenges of Self-Rescue Choking Management

Performing the Heimlich Maneuver on oneself presents distinct physiological hurdles. Unlike a bystander-delivered abdominal thrust, which utilizes external leverage, a self-rescue thrust requires the victim to position their own hands under the ribcage or manually impact their epigastrium against an external object (e.g., a chair back, railing, or table corner). This maneuver relies on creating a sudden increase in intra-thoracic pressure to force the foreign object out of the trachea.

To train individuals on this vital distinction, advanced simulation systems utilize specially calibrated compression mechanisms. Trainees must apply force in an upward, inward trajectory, learning the precise angle and force thresholds required to expel a foreign body without causing internal soft-tissue damage. Q1: Can you actually perform the Heimlich Maneuver on yourself successfully?
Yes, it is entirely possible. If you are alone and choking, make a fist with one hand, place the thumb side against your abdomen above the navel and below the breastbone, and grab the fist with your other hand. Press inward and upward with quick, forceful thrusts. Alternatively, press your upper abdomen firmly against a stable horizontal edge (like a chair back, counter, or table edge) and thrust downward to force the obstruction out.
Q2: What are the main limitations of training with low-cost or homemade self-rescue tools?
Homemade training tools lack anatomical realism, calibrated pressure indicators, and consistent airway simulation. Without professional training models, users risk practicing at incorrect angles or applying excessive, unsafe pressure that could cause abdominal injury in a real emergency.
Q3: Why is high-fidelity simulation crucial for teaching choking rescue?
High-fidelity simulators provide tactile realism, allowing trainees to build accurate muscle memory. Real-time feedback mechanisms help users gauge whether their thrusts have the necessary force and direction to successfully clear the airway.
